Leaf & Yark - Christmas Tree Collection

Reminder:
Set your Christmas tree out in accordance to the City’s Christmas tree collection requirements. 

Collection day:

Christmas tree collection occurs on your regular collection day during a predetermined two week time frame in January.  Refer to the collection schedule for your specific collection dates.

Collection time:

Place your Christmas trees at the curb no earlier than 6:00 p.m. the night before collection and no later than 7:00 a.m. the day of collection. The time of collection in your area may change at any time.

Placement of materials:

Christmas trees buried in snow banks may not get pick-up.  Ensure trees are accessible

For easy identification for the contractor, please have clear separation for each waste stream
Ensure all materials place out for collection are in accordance with the City’s set out requirements
Please place your collectable materials at the curbside for collection.  Do not place collectible materials on the road, as it may pose a hazard to vehicular traffic
Keep waste materials separate from your neighbours

Prepare trees properly:

Remove all tinsel, ornaments, plastic bags and tree stands


Permitted length:

Christmas trees can be no larger than 2.13 m. (7 ft.).  Christmas trees larger than 2.13 m. (7 ft.) must be cut in half.  Large tree can not fit into our collection vehicles.

Forgot to put your Christmas tree out for collection?
If you miss your Christmas tree collection dates, your can take your tree to the Compost Facility (no charge) or wait until the start of the City’s Spring leaf and yard collection program.  Please see the Compost Facility section in this website for the compost facility location and hours of operation.
